The Role of Technology
The evolution of insemination would not have been possible without advancements in technology. In the early days, the process was done manually, with a syringe or pipette used to introduce the sperm into the reproductive tract. This method had a low success rate and was also expensive.

However, with the introduction of intrauterine insemination (IUI) in the 1970s, the success rates of insemination increased significantly. IUI involves placing the sperm directly into the uterus, increasing the chances of fertilization. This method also allowed for the use of washed sperm, which removes any impurities and increases the chances of fertilization.

In recent years, the use of assisted reproductive technologies (ART) has further revolutionized the field of insemination. In vitro fertilization (IVF) and intracytoplasmic sperm injection (ICSI) are two ART techniques that have significantly improved the success rates of insemination. IVF involves fertilizing the egg outside the body and then transferring the embryo into the woman’s uterus, while ICSI involves injecting a single sperm directly into the egg.

The Use of Donor Sperm
One of the significant changes in the evolution of insemination is the use of donor sperm. In the past, donor insemination was a secretive and taboo topic, with little information available to the public. However, with the rise of fertility clinics and sperm banks, donor insemination has become a more accepted and accessible option for couples.

Today, sperm donors are thoroughly screened for diseases and genetic disorders, making it a safe and reliable option for couples. Donor sperm can also be chosen based on specific characteristics, such as physical appearance and education level, allowing couples to have some control over the genetic makeup of their child.

The Future of Insemination
As technology and medical research continue to advance, the future of insemination looks promising. Researchers are currently exploring the use of artificial wombs, which could potentially eliminate the need for a female reproductive tract in the fertilization process. This could be a game-changer for same-sex couples and those struggling with fertility issues.

Moreover, the use of genetic testing in combination with insemination could also increase the chances of having a healthy baby. Preimplantation genetic testing (PGT) involves screening embryos for genetic disorders before implantation, reducing the risk of passing on hereditary diseases to the child.
